The paper considers the capacity of a polycondenser and the module of a family of measures associated with the class of curves connecting the polycondenser’s plates. It is proved that these quantities are equal. Also a relation between the polycondenser’s capacity and the module of a family of vector measures associated with the class of functions admissible for the polycondenser’s capacity is established. The results obtained generalize the earlier results by M. Ohtsuka and H. Aikawa.
